So here is a card I made a bit back but haven't blogged.  




Just a digi image I had on my computer - no idea where its from, coloured with pro markers the wedding theme is cadbury's purple - I know this cos I did the invites and my daughter is maid of honour! I used the flower border and corner stamp from a Claritystamp set of little miniatures the round wedding day stamp is from either lily of the valley or little claire and a metal embelly from my stash .

Now I have to be honest here - I did these some time ago and I have lost the scrap of paper where I scribble down what I did  but I do know that I did the backgrounds on the gelli plate 
I think the one on the right started off as blue on the plate and then I took some off using crumpled paper, took a print, then repeated the process with some brown.  I cleaned off the plate and using a some blue, white and silver in random patches, added the stencil and pulled a print.

The one on the right was pulled with what was left on the plate from the first one and forms the base behind the tag of the first and the background for the second tag.  I got some of the tall thin flowers and the verse n the recent members sale and stamped over the top with coffee archival on the left and embossing with silver on the right.  I stamped the snow drop out again on paper and coloured with pencils, cut out and overlayed on the tag and on the right I coloured with pencils directly on to the tag
